Hag Fold train station provides basic yet adequate facilities for passengers. The station lacks a ticket machine and online ticket collection services, so it's recommended to plan your travel arrangements in advance. For ticket inquiries, there's a staffed office available Monday to Friday from 06:25 to 12:55. Fortunately, travelers can utilize the induction loop available for those with hearing impairments.
Although there is no official waiting room, seating areas are available for your convenience. Bear in mind, however, that amenities such as toilets, refreshments, and shops are not available at this station. Moreover, the station does have CCTV to enhance passenger security, ensuring safety as you await your train.
Travelers with accessibility needs will find partial step-free access at Hag Fold. Accessing services towards Manchester involves a couple of ramps, while services towards Wigan require a ramp through a gate. It’s worth noting that there are no accessible ticket machines or toilets available. However, ramps are provided for train access, and passenger assistance can be booked in advance. For more details, a 360-degree map is available online to help plan your visit.
While the station itself may have limited facilities, Hag Fold connects you seamlessly to other transportation modes. Rail replacement services operate from the bus stops under the railway bridge. Buses serving routes to Bolton and Atherton can be accessed on Spa Road, with detailed information through Busline at 0870 608 2608. Unfortunately, bicycle hire is not offered at this station, but taxis can be arranged via Cab4You.

New Beckenham station is designed to meet the needs of modern passengers with several facilities to make your journey smooth and hassle-free. Ticket purchase is made easy with a ticket office open during weekday mornings and Saturdays. For those buying tickets online, collection is available through the ticket machine, which is conveniently located at the station forecourt and accessibility-friendly. The station also supports smartcards, allowing easy and fast travel without the fuss of traditional tickets.
While there's no waiting room or accessible toilets, passengers can find a seating area and a coffee kiosk to grab refreshments. A secure station accreditation ensures additional peace of mind with CCTV surveillance keeping an eye on activities. Although provision for step-free access is limited, assistance for those requiring help to navigate through the station is readily available during staffing hours.
The connectivity at New Beckenham doesn't stop at rail services. The station offers seamless transport links, including a rail replacement service with buses to nearby Lewisham and Hayes. If you're planning to explore more of the area, comprehensive information for local bus services is readily available online, ensuring you can continue your journey with ease.
